Search FHIR

ANS IG document core
0.1.0 - ci-build France flag

ANS IG document core - version de développement local (v0.1.0) construite par les outils de publication FHIR (HL7® FHIR® Standard). Voir le répertoire des versions publiées

Resource Profile: FRDeviceRequestDocument - Mappings

Draft as of 2025-12-05

Mappings for the fr-device-request-document resource profile.

Mappings to Structures in this Implementation Guide

No Mappings Found

Mappings to other Structures

No Mappings Found

Other Mappings

NomWorkflow PatternHL7 v2 MappingRIM MappingFiveWs Pattern MappingQuality Improvement and Clinical Knowledge (QUICK)doco
.. DeviceRequest
Request
ORC
Act[moodCode<=INT]
... id
... meta
... implicitRules
... language
... text
Act.text?
... contained
N/A
... Slices pour extension
.... extension:notCovered
... modifierExtension
N/A
... identifier
Request.identifier
  • ORC.2
  • ORC.3
.identifier
FiveWs.identifier
ClinicalStatement.identifier
... instantiatesCanonical
Request.instantiatesCanonical
Varies by domain
.outboundRelationship[typeCode=DEFN].target
... instantiatesUri
Request.instantiatesUri
Varies by domain
.outboundRelationship[typeCode=DEFN].target
... basedOn
Request.basedOn
ORC.8 (plus others)
.outboundRelationship[typeCode=FLFS].target
Proposal.prnReason.reason
... priorRequest
Request.replaces
Handled by message location of ORC (ORC.1=RO or RU)
.outboundRelationship[typeCode=RPLC].target
... groupIdentifier
Request.groupIdentifier
ORC.4
.inboundRelationship(typeCode=COMP].source[moodCode=INT].identifier
... status
Request.status
ORC.5
.status
FiveWs.status
Action.currentStatus
... intent
Request.intent
N/A
.moodCode (nuances beyond PRP/PLAN/RQO would need to be elsewhere)
FiveWs.class
... priority
Request.priority
TQ1.9
.priorityCode
FiveWs.grade
... Slices pour code[x]
Request.code
Varies by domain
.code
FiveWs.what[x]
DeviceUse.device
.... code[x]:codeReference
Request.code
Varies by domain
.code
FiveWs.what[x]
DeviceUse.device
... parameter
Varies by domain
.code
FiveWs.what[x]
DeviceUse.device
.... id
n/a
.... extension
n/a
.... modifierExtension
N/A
.... code
Varies by domain
.code
FiveWs.what[x]
DeviceUse.device
.... Slices pour value[x]
Varies by domain
.code
FiveWs.what[x]
DeviceUse.device
..... value[x]:valueQuantity
Varies by domain
.code
FiveWs.what[x]
DeviceUse.device
... subject
Request.subject
Accompanying PID segment
.participation[typeCode=SBJ].role
FiveWs.subject
ClinicalStatement.subject
... encounter
Request.encounter
Accompanying PV1
  • .inboundRelationship(typeCode=COMP].source[classCode<=PCPR
  • moodCode=EVN]
FiveWs.context
ClinicalStatement.encounter
... Slices pour occurrence[x]
Request.occurrence[x]
Accompanying TQ1/TQ2 segments
.effectiveTime
FiveWs.planned
DeviceUse.applicationSchedule
.... occurrence[x]:occurrenceTiming
Request.occurrence[x]
Accompanying TQ1/TQ2 segments
.effectiveTime
FiveWs.planned
DeviceUse.applicationSchedule
..... id
n/a
..... extension
n/a
..... modifierExtension
N/A
..... event
QLIST<TS>
..... repeat
Implies PIVL or EIVL
...... id
n/a
...... extension
n/a
...... bounds[x]
IVL(TS) used in a QSI
...... count
PIVL.count
...... countMax
PIVL.count
...... duration
PIVL.phase
...... durationMax
PIVL.phase
...... durationUnit
PIVL.phase.unit
...... frequency
PIVL.phase
...... frequencyMax
PIVL.phase
...... period
PIVL.phase
...... periodMax
PIVL.phase
...... periodUnit
PIVL.phase.unit
...... dayOfWeek
n/a
...... timeOfDay
n/a
...... when
EIVL.event
...... offset
EIVL.offset
..... code
QSC.code
.... occurrence[x]:occurrencePeriod
Request.occurrence[x]
Accompanying TQ1/TQ2 segments
.effectiveTime
FiveWs.planned
DeviceUse.applicationSchedule
... authoredOn
Request.authoredOn
ORC.9
.participation[typeCode=AUT].time
FiveWs.recorded
ClinicalStatement.statementDateTime
... requester
Request.requester
ORC.12
.participation[typeCode=AUT].role
FiveWs.author
.... id
n/a
.... Slices pour extension
n/a
..... extension:prescripteur
...... id
n/a
...... Slices pour extension
....... extension:type
........ id
n/a
........ extension
........ url
N/A
........ value[x]
N/A
....... extension:typeCode
........ id
n/a
........ extension
........ url
N/A
........ value[x]
N/A
....... extension:actor
........ id
n/a
........ extension
........ url
N/A
........ value[x]
N/A
...... url
N/A
...... value[x]
N/A
.... reference
N/A
.... type
N/A
.... identifier
.identifier
.... display
N/A
... performerType
Request.performerType
PRT
.participation[typeCode=PRF].role[scoper.determinerCode=KIND].code
FiveWs.actor
... performer
Request.performer
PRT
.participation[typeCode=PRF].role[scoper.determinerCode=INSTANCE]
FiveWs.actor
... reasonCode
Request.reasonCode
ORC.16
.reasonCode
FiveWs.why[x]
Action.indication.reason
... Slices pour reasonReference
Request.reasonReference
ORC.16
.outboundRelationship[typeCode=RSON].target
FiveWs.why[x]
.... reasonReference:EnRapportAvecALD
Request.reasonReference
ORC.16
.outboundRelationship[typeCode=RSON].target
FiveWs.why[x]
.... reasonReference:EnRapportAvecAccidentTravail
Request.reasonReference
ORC.16
.outboundRelationship[typeCode=RSON].target
FiveWs.why[x]
.... reasonReference:EnRapportAvecLaPrevention
Request.reasonReference
ORC.16
.outboundRelationship[typeCode=RSON].target
FiveWs.why[x]
... insurance
Request.insurance
IN1/IN2
.outboundRelationship[typeCode=COVBY].target
... supportingInfo
Request.supportingInfo
Accompanying segments
.outboundRelationship[typeCode=PERT].target
... note
Request.note
NTE
  • .inboundRelationship(typeCode=SUBJ].source[classCode=ANNGEN
  • type=ST]
ClinicalStatement.additionalText
... relevantHistory
Request.relevantHistory
N/A
  • .inboundRelationship(typeCode=SUBJ].source[classCode=CACT
  • moodCode=EVN]

doco Documentation pour ce format